What Exactly Are Penny Slots?
Despite the name, modern penny slots rarely cost just one cent per spin. The term now broadly refers to games with a very low minimum bet, often starting between $0.10 and $0.20. This is achieved by allowing you to bet on a high number of paylines (e.g., 50 lines) at a minimal cost per line (e.g., $0.004). The key advantage is longevity; a $20 deposit can yield hundreds of spins, making it ideal for casual or budget-conscious play. Understanding RTP and Volatility
To make informed choices, you must understand two key concepts: Return to Player (RTP) and volatility. RTP is a theoretical percentage indicating the amount a slot pays back to players over time. For penny slots, aim for games with an RTP of 96% or higher. Volatility refers to the risk involved. Low-volatility slots pay out smaller wins more frequently, which is ideal for preserving your bankroll during long sessions. High-volatility slots offer larger but less frequent payouts. For low-stake play, low to medium volatility games are generally recommended.

Smart Bankroll Management Strategies
The core of successful low-stake play is disciplined bankroll management. Decide on a loss limit for your session before you start—a good rule is to never risk more than 5% of your total bankroll in a single session. Use the autoplay function with a loss limit feature if available, which will stop spins once you’ve reached your predetermined threshold. Equally important is setting a win goal; decide on a percentage profit (e.g., 50%) at which you will cash out. This disciplined approach ensures that your gaming remains entertaining and sustainable.
